    I know there are external differences between the QV and the 3.2, and of course, there is the engine difference.

    However, can anyone detailed out any differences in the QV and 3.2 interior or electronics? Are they both the same? Seats? Dash? Gauges? Switches?

    Same with the Cabrio's, are there any differences between the QV and 3.2 cabs? Do they have the same tops, top dimensions, mechanisms?

    There were definitely changes to the interior for the t 3.4, but I thought the QV and 3.2s were basically the same.

    The one that makes all the difference for me,
    the elegant and unusual (brushed aluminum?) interior handle/locking of the earlier

    http://sportscarbible.com/_images/ferrari/ferrari-mondial/ferrari-mondial-lg/ferrari-mondial-lp1110299scb.jpg

    versus the more common look (Alfa?) of the later

    http://www.classicitaliancarsforsale.com/wp-content/uploads/2012/08/kA_800.jpeg

    The earlier leaves your average passenger completely clueless as how to open the door himself, some have mistaken it for the window regulator switch and pressed for quite a while before reporting back a malfunction ;-)

    Those are identical QV and 3.2...the wires that are leaving both fuseboxes have identical connections. A minor difference interior harness is possible.

    Guido is likely right here, but it should be noted that the color coding on the wires themselves has undergone a few changes. For all I know, the guys at the factory just used whatever was lying on the floor that day to wire up my harness... not much of it matches the manual.

    My '88 3.2 with ABS has a different indicator panel to make room for the ABS light.

    Cabrios have a rear window lock switch with indicator light and coupes have rear defrost switch that the cabrio lacks.
